Prevention Services updates communicable-disease monitoring to Cascade County Board of Health

Cascade County Board of Health · March 4, 2026

Penny Paul presented the Prevention Services Division’s monthly status report and provided the board with a communicable‑disease update during the March 4 meeting.

The minutes record a question from Vice‑Chair Laurie Glover during the communicable‑disease segment and broader board discussion following the report. The written record summarizes that the report and ensuing discussion occurred but does not include numerical case counts, specific surveillance metrics, or operational response steps; those details may be available in the meeting audio noted on cascadecountymt.gov.

Board members and staff discussed elements of prevention services and monitoring but the minutes show no formal vote or directive recorded in the written minutes. The update was presented as routine oversight of communicable‑disease activities for Cascade County residents.
